INFORMATION BULLETIN ON VARIABLE STARS Number 2385 Konkoly Observatory Budapest 18 August 1983 HU ISSN 0374-0676 PHOTOELECTRIC MINIMA OF ECLIPSING BINARIES The following Table gives photoelectric minima, mostly obtained during the year 1982 at the Ege University Observatory, Izmir (Turkey) and the Nurnberg Observatory (Germany). Minima of eclipsing binaries observed at both observatories 1960 - 1981 were published in Astr. Nachr. 288, 69 (1964); 289, 191 (1966); 291, 111 (1968); I.B.V.S. No. 456 (1970), 530 (1971), 647 (1972), 937 (1974), 1053 (1975), 1163 (1976), 1358 (1977), 1449 (1978), 1924 (1981) and 2189 (1982). The Table gives the heliocentric minima, three different O-C's, the type of filter, UBV, the abbreviations of the names of the observers and the type of the instruments used (Izmir: 48 cm Cassegrain, Nurnberg: 34 cm Cassegrain, both with phototube 1P21). Space Science 64, 421, 1979) The (O-C)'s for secondary minima (Min II) were calculated on the supposition, that they are symmetric between primary minima (if no special data are given). The sign = between O-C (I) and O-C (II) indicates that the elements (I) and (II) are equal. The sign: means that the time of minimum (last decimal) is uncertain. E. POHL E. HAMZAOGLU, N. GUDUR, C.
